About Nielsen Company

Nielsen is a global leader in audience measurement, data, and analytics, shaping the future of media. Measuring behaviour across all channels and platforms to discover what audiences love, they empower their clients with trusted intelligence that fuels action.

Your role

Nielsen Sports is looking for a new team member to join the growing Client Service team, who are responsible for managing the relationships with our portfolio of clients. This role would suit someone who is looking to take on a client-facing role and has an interest in sports marketing and research.

Nielsen Sports is a trusted adviser and partner in sports and entertainment consumer research, media evaluation, and data-driven consultancy, helping clients worldwide to plan, optimise and measure the impact of their initiatives against business objectives. With its expansive suite of products and services, Nielsen Sports is uniquely positioned to provide data-driven insights and intelligence which help drive more effective decision-making for clients.

Responsibilities

  • Day-to-day contact for a range of clients, responsible for maintaining client relationships with support from the broader Client Service team
  • Oversee the end-to-end project delivery for client projects (including kick-off through to presentation), covering consumer insights, media evaluation, sponsorship valuations, and economic impact studies
  • Identify opportunities to help grow the business and drive outcomes for clients, with support from the broader Client Service team  
  • Assist in contract negotiations within your client portfolio
  • On-boarding and training clients on Nielsen-owned analysis tools
  • You will be required to monitor and manage processes, both internal and external, work closely with other Nielsen team members and interact with clients

About you

Here’s what we are looking for in this role:

  • Bachelor's Degree, preferably with a business/commerce background (recent university graduates are encouraged to apply)
  • Interest in the business of sports, media, events, and entertainment and a sound understanding of the Australian sports landscape
  • Excellent communication skills, both written and verbal, and a high level of business acumen
  • Commercial mindset and acumen 
  • Understanding of numbers, with the ability to interpret and present data
  • Past experience with sales, customer, or client-facing roles in a sport, marketing, or business environment would be looked upon favourably
